2,215 research outputs found

    Circulant and skew-circulant matrices as new normal-form realization of IIR digital filters

    Get PDF
    Normal-form fixed-point state-space realization of IIR (infinite-impulse response) filters are known to be free from both overflow oscillations and roundoff limit cycles, provided magnitude truncation arithmetic is used together with two's-complement overflow features. Two normal-form realizations are derived that utilize circulant and skew-circulant matrices as their state transition matrices. The advantage of these realizations is that the A-matrix has only N (rather than N2) distinct elements and is amenable to efficient memory-oriented implementation. The problem of scaling the internal signals in these structures is addressed, and it is shown that an approximate solution can be obtained through a numerical optimization method. Several numerical examples are included

    A new approach to the realization of low-sensitivity IIR digital filters

    Get PDF
    A new implementation of an IIR digital filter transfer function is presented that is structurally passive and, hence, has extremely low pass-band sensitivity. The structure is based on a simple parallel interconnection of two all-pass sections, with each section implemented in a structurally lossless manner. The structure shares a number of properties in common with wave lattice digital filters. Computer simulation results verifying the low-sensitivity feature are included, along with results on roundoff noise/dynamic range interaction. A large number of alternatives is available for the implementation of the all-pass sections, giving rise to the well-known wave lattice digital filters as a specific instance of the implementation

    Passive cascaded-lattice structures for low-sensitivity FIR filter design, with applications to filter banks

    Get PDF
    A class of nonrecursive cascaded-lattice structures is derived, for the implementation of finite-impulse response (FIR) digital filters. The building blocks are lossless and the transfer function can be implemented as a sequence of planar rotations. The structures can be used for the synthesis of any scalar FIR transfer function H(z) with no restriction on the location of zeros; at the same time, all the lattice coefficients have magnitude bounded above by unity. The structures have excellent passband sensitivity because of inherent passivity, and are automatically internally scaled, in an L_2 sense. The ideas are also extended for the realization of a bank of MFIR transfer functions as a cascaded lattice. Applications of these structures in subband coding and in multirate signal processing are outlined. Numerical design examples are included

    Minimal structures for the implementation of digital rational lossless systems

    Get PDF
    Digital lossless transfer matrices and vectors (power-complementary vectors) are discussed for applications in digital filter bank systems, both single rate and multirate. Two structures for the implementation of rational lossless systems are presented. The first structure represents a characterization of single-input, multioutput lossless systems in terms of complex planar rotations, whereas the second structure offers a representation of M-input, M-output lossless systems in terms of unit-norm vectors. This property makes the second structure desirable in applications that involve optimization of the parameters. Modifications of the second structure for implementing single-input, multioutput, and lossless bounded real (LBR) systems are also included. The main importance of the structures is that they are completely general, i.e. they span the entire set of M×1 and M×M lossless systems. This is demonstrated by showing that any such system can be synthesized using these structures. The structures are also minimal in the sense that they use the smallest number of scalar delays and parameters to implement a lossless system of given degree and dimensions. A design example to demonstrate the main results is included

    Digital filter design using root moments for sum-of-all-pass structures from complete and partial specifications

    Get PDF
    Published versio

    An improved sufficient condition for absence of limit cycles in digital filters

    Get PDF
    It is known that if the state transition matrix A of a digital filter structure is such that D - A^{dagger}DA is positive definite for some diagonal matrix D of positive elements, then all zero-input limit cycles can be suppressed. This paper shows that positive semidefiniteness of D - A^{dagger}DA is in fact sufficient. As a result, it is now possible to explain the absence of limit cycles in Gray-Markel lattice structures based only on the state-space viewpoint
    corecore